Can you explain a little more of what it is? I think my wife would love this
Basically its just yoga done in a heated room. And it's about as hot as a sauna in there!

The class I went to was beginner level so the moves weren't difficult at all but being in the heat made it feel like a real workout. It was amazing! They shut the lights off at the end and everyone kind of winds down (but I missed that part ). Make sure to drink A LOT before going and while there and not to eat a couple hours before either.

Originally posted by ejrbrndps
heard it was dangerous
I just did a little reading up on it. I read that instructors will tell you to just push through it if you get dizzy or nauseous and it can be risky for people with heart conditions or low or high blood pressure.

I have very low blood pressure which may have had something to do with why I was unable to finish the class. I'll keep this in mind for my next class and see how I feel.

I didn't push myself though. You can pull muscles more easily in that kind of heat too. So you really have to listen to your body. If it's not agreeing with the heat, then hot yoga might not be for you.
